
Clara Marie Wakeman, 94, of Oak Grove, MO, passed away on Friday, November 14, 2025, at Aspire Senior Living in Oak Grove. A Celebration of Life will be held Monday, November 24th from 5:00 p.m. to 7:00 p.m. at Royer Funeral Home in Oak Grove, MO.
Clara was born February 27, 1931, in Concordia, MO, to James Dewey and Lillie Lee (Ward) Williams. Clara worked for Branum Drug Store for many years and then later at Purcell Drug Store. She was the first lady of Oak Grove 3 times. Clara enjoyed needle point and working on puzzles. She also enjoyed going to horse shows with her son Steven and was very involved in the Oak Grove Saddle Club.
Clara was preceded in death by her parents, husband Richard “Kenneth” Wakeman, son Donald Eugene Wakeman, and several siblings.
Clara is survived by 2 sons, Richard Wakeman of Blue Springs, MO and Steven Wakeman of Kansas City, MO; granddaughter, Tina Kidd of Holden, MO; granddaughter, Michelle Wakeman-Haney of Lee’s Summit, MO, and great-grandsons, Carter & Parker Haney; grandson, Tom Wakeman and granddaughter, Sara Wakeman, both of Germany; sister, Wanda Langley of Kansas; and many nieces and nephews.
